A business phone install is three pieces: a hosted phone system in the cloud, the SIP signaling that connects to the public phone network, and the handsets your team actually picks up. The Tustin technician arrives with everything pre-staged.

  • Hosted phone system in the cloud

    Extensions, voicemail, auto-attendant, BLF presence, call parking, paging zones, and shared lines run from the cloud PBX, so there is no on-site PBX appliance to rack, no copper to maintain. The Tustin team handles configuration and upgrades from the admin portal.
  • Number porting before cutover

    Main lines, direct extensions, fax DIDs, and call-tracking numbers port into the platform two to four weeks before cutover. The actual switch happens after hours so inbound calls never drop. The losing carrier paperwork is handled end-to-end.
  • Yealink desks + mobile + desktop apps

    Yealink T-series handsets ship pre-provisioned. The VanceTel softphone runs on iOS, Android, Mac, and Windows so field staff carry the desk extension without exposing personal numbers. Voicemail-to-email lands in the same inbox the office already checks.

The price you see is the price you pay

Voice (calls, auto-attendant, voicemail) is $24 per extension per month. Voice + Text (everything in Voice plus native SMS and MMS from the company number) is $34 per extension per month. Both are all-in: taxes, USF, 911, and surcharges are included, so the price you see is the price on the invoice. Those are 3-year contract prices, paid monthly; month-to-month is $32 and $45. Either way: $0 setup, a 30-day money-back guarantee with no conditions, and you cancel online with 30 days notice. A contract never auto-renews into a new term. Yes. Every main line, direct extension, fax DID, and tracking number ports into VanceTel before cutover. Porting takes two to four weeks depending on your current carrier, and we schedule the actual switch for after business hours so no inbound calls drop. We handle every form and follow up with the losing carrier directly.

The VanceTel softphone is native on iPhone, iPad, Mac, and Vision Pro, plus Windows and the web, with Android coming. Calls, texts, and voicemail live in one app across every device. Your desk extension follows you, without exposing your personal number. Pair it with a Yealink desk phone or run softphone-only; both are first-class on the platform.

Native business SMS is built into the Voice + Text plan, with no separate texting app, no second invoice, and no extra subscription. Each extension includes 250 text segments a month, pooled across the account, with 2¢ per segment after that. We handle the 10DLC registration for you (the carrier fee is passed through at cost), so two-way texting works on day one from the same business number you call out from.

Your choice. Voice is $24 and Voice + Text is $34 per extension per month on a 3-year contract, paid monthly, or $32 and $45 month-to-month. A 3-year contract rolls to month-to-month at the same price when it ends and never auto-renews into a new term. Either way you cancel online with 30 days notice, and the first 30 days are money-back with no conditions.
